5. Bedienungsanleitung
5.1 Patientenvorbereitung
For accurate readings, ensure the patient is relaxed, seated comfortably with their back supported, and their arm supported at heart level. Avoid talking or moving during the measurement.
5.2 Manschettenplatzierung
- Select the appropriate cuff size for the patient's arm circumference. The cuff bladder should encircle at least 80% of the arm.
- Wrap the cuff firmly around the patient's bare upper arm, approximately 1-2 cm above the elbow joint. The artery mark on the cuff should align with the brachial artery.
- Ensure the cuff is not too tight or too loose.
5.3 Taking a Blood Pressure Reading
- Turn on the Connex ProBP 3400 device.
- Ensure the cuff is correctly placed and connected.
- Press the START button on the device. The cuff will inflate automatically.
- The device will detect the blood pressure and display the systolic, diastolic, and pulse rate readings on the screen.
- The device is designed to obtain accurate readings even in the presence of some motion or a weak pulse.
- Once the measurement is complete, the cuff will deflate.
- Record the readings as necessary.

7. Fehlerbehebung
This section addresses common issues you might encounter. If the problem persists, contact Welch Allyn customer support.
| Problem | Mögliche Ursache | Lösung |
|---|---|---|
| Gerät lässt sich nicht einschalten | Low or depleted battery; Power adapter not connected; Device malfunction | Connect to AC power; Ensure battery is charged; Check power button; Contact support if issue persists. |
| Error message during measurement | Cuff not properly applied; Patient movement; Cuff leak; Arrhythmia detected | Reapply cuff correctly; Ensure patient remains still; Check cuff and tubing for leaks; Retake measurement. |
| Ungenaue Messwerte | Incorrect cuff size; Improper cuff placement; Patient not relaxed; Device needs calibration | Verify cuff size and placement; Ensure patient is calm and still; Contact support for calibration if suspected. |
| Cannot connect to EHR/EMR | USB cable issue; Software driver missing; EHR/EMR system configuration | Check USB cable connection; Install necessary drivers; Consult EHR/EMR system administrator. |
